NIGHTFALL Premiere New Music Video ‘Martyrs of the Cult of the Dead (Agita)’

Posted by tarjavirmakari on June 18, 2021
Posted in: Int. News, News. Tagged: Nightfall. Leave a comment

Greek melodic metal masters NIGHTFALL are now premiering the official music video for the song “Martyrs of the Cult of the Dead (Agita)” via OnlyFans! The decision to use this platform is to circumvent the arbitrary and harsh censorship restrictions across all social media, including YouTube, due to nudity and excessive violence. The video, which was created by Antoine de Montremy, can be seen for FREE at THIS LOCATION.

NIGHTFALL vocalist Efthimis Karadimas comments, “We are honored to have our ‘Martyrs of the Cult of the Dead,’ aka ‘Agita,’ being made by Antoine de Montremy, the producer of Chris Holmes’ documentary ‘Mean Man’ (official selection in 2020 Hollywood Gold Awards, Florence Film Awards, Orlando Film Festival and FMX) and his fabulous team. The video is based on ‘Agita’ lyrics and it represents the struggle with depression through its personification in female form (the word “depression” is a female noun in the Greek language). OnlyFans premiere has been chosen to avoid problems with YouTube’s strict policy towards nudity and violence. Especially the latter. This is not a porn video.”

Video director Antoine de Montremy adds, “In pure Nightfall fashion, approaching this video and the song’s concept has been quite a challenge: Efthimis already had a very precise vision for ‘Agita’ and we wanted to honor both the song and its message.

“Opening up about depression and its very solitary struggle is quite a brave move in nowadays so well polished metal world. Introducing female metaphors and pushing all boundaries was the only path to illustrate this inner struggle between love and hate, comfort and fear, joy and despair.

“Blessed with Hanna and Fanny’s outstanding performances – embodying all feelings human mind can experience – and thanks to the greatest filming crew ever, we are happy to unleash the fury of Agita to the world!”

Brazilian PENTRAL Release New Video ‘The Shell I’m Living In’

Posted by tarjavirmakari on June 18, 2021
Posted in: Int. News, News. Tagged: PENTRAL. Leave a comment

PENTRAL announce the release of the second video, The Shell I’m Living In, from their album “What Lies Ahead Of Us”. The video was premiered on BraveWords and is now available worldwide. You can watch the video below.

Listen and purchase PENTRAL: http://www.smarturl.it/pentral

Lead singer Victor Lima discussed the new video, “The Music video was recorded in our home town in Brazil – Belem, with many shots taken from the historic center of the city and some scenes in flashback from the previous recordings in the woods nearby, and the band playing in the forest as well. We had some issues doing that because many scenes were captured in the middle of people who were in their ordinary working days. This was intentional to make it more authentic, as many people there were doing their own things, and we naturally paid attention not to show anyone’s clear image without their previous approval. The recordings of “The Shell I’m Living In” took us a couple of days. We’ve been graced with amazing days and nights, brilliant acting performances from the actresses Anne and Duda, an inspiring direction by Roger Elarrat and beautiful Photography by Lucas Escocio. The whole team was incredible  and emotive, and this intense atmosphere really stood out through the video.”

JINJER Announce New Album “Wallflowers”, Reveal First Single ‘Vortex’

Posted by tarjavirmakari on June 18, 2021
Posted in: Int. News, News. Tagged: JINJER. Leave a comment
[photo credit: Alina Chernohor]

Teased over the last few months with just the hashtag #JINJER4, JINJER have now dropped the biggest heavy music news of the year: The band will release their long-awaited new studio album, entitled Wallflowers, on August 27, 2021 via Napalm Records.
 
Through their relentless hard work, non-stop international touring and critically acclaimed chart-topping releases gaining them over 250 million cross-platform streams/views – JINJER are inarguably one of modern metal’s hottest and most exciting bands today. The band has become synonymous with doing things their own way and breaking every rule in the heavy metal handbook, which is loudly evident on their highly anticipated fourth studio album and the successor to the groundbreaking Macro.
 

Eugene Abdukhanov adds:
“Growing creatively has always been a major goal for us. The day JINJER stops reaching for new musical horizons- will be our last day as a band. We could have churned out what our peers expected us to do or produce Pisces clones without end but we’ve never done that and we never will. Instead, we wrote an album whose level of emotions range from the fiercest aggression we’ve ever had, to the most intricate melodies and melancholic vibes you could ever get from our music. We decided to rip apart all possible stylistic boundaries without regard to financial success or competing with our previous albums. Wallflowers is a different kind of album musically and visually. It’s about our identity as a band, as individuals and a clear statement that we are different from most artists … and that it is OK to do your own thing.”
 

Already regarded as one of the most anticipated metal albums of the year, with Wallflowers, JINJER once again prove their exceptional knack for mixing groove, prog, alternative and experimental influences to create a sound unlike anything that has ever come before it.
 

JINJER’s first video and single “Vortex” drop jaws with a massive look and some serious groove!

Along with an impressive new music video, the band just dropped their hypnotizing first single “Vortex”. This first taste of the new album features Shmayluk’s vocal power entwining with the eclectic, propulsive spiral aura of the track, not only showcasing the four-piece’s tonal diversity, but also proving their individuality once again. The accompanying music video holds up a black mirror to current world events: Qualitatively in the absolute top league and featuring an interplay of potent band shots and virtual features, the four minute track devours the viewer with destructive energy, and on the other hand represents the gloomy, absorbing mood and oppression of an entire period of time.

JINJER state:
“”Vortex” is the first. The first song we recorded and the first single we played live (at Hellfest From Home 2021). This is a perfectly balanced song in our opinion. A story told through the music and it deserved a video to perfectly match it… The video is a journey, giving the single another layer, another message, as Tatiana sings about the burden of heavy thoughts and how devastating it can be, the video mirrors what the world has sadly become for many of us …”

Watch/Listen to “Vortex” HERE:

Wallflowers not only presents a methodical and premeditated next step in the band’s already imposing career, but moreover, it mirrors the personal adversities they’ve faced due to the worldwide events over the last year. Wallflowers is not only an upgrade to the progressive groove metal sound that all JINJER fans crave, but also a sonic pressure cooker of technical musicianship, emotional fury and an intense soundtrack befitting the harrowing state of the world today. Hailing from the conflict-ridden Ukrainian region of Donetsk but now calling Kiev their home base, JINJER truly do not mince words – or riffs – on Wallflowers. Their exceptional precision of modern metal paired with tough as nails attitude has earned them a fiercely loyal, rabid fanbase and massive critical acclaim, making JINJER one of the most talked about bands today and garnering them many sold out performances across the globe. With nearly all of JINJER’s releases composed between vans, backstage rooms and constant touring, Wallflowers continues where its predecessor Macro left off, only this time with less distraction and more time to focus on songwriting.

INHUMAN CONDITION Announce “Tourantula” East Coast US Tour for September

Posted by tarjavirmakari on June 17, 2021
Posted in: Int. News, News. Tagged: INHUMAN CONDITION. Leave a comment
Photo by Deidra Kling

Florida death/thrash trio INHUMAN CONDITION have announced their first tour supporting their recently-released debut album Rat°God.  The band has teamed up with Nice Guy Booking for an East Coast US run of “Tourantula”, kicking off on September 4th in Orlando.  Support on the tour will come from Chicago-based death metal/black metal band CRUSADIST. Tickets will be on sale soon.

INHUMAN CONDITION showed up on the scene earlier this year, releasing 4 singles between the end of April and the album’s release date on June 4th on Listenable Insanity Records.  The music for Rat°God was written by Taylor Nordberg (Guitars, THE ABSENCE, FORE) and Jeramie Kling (Vocals, Drums – VENOM INC, THE ABSENCE, FORE) in the fall of 2019 for what was to be the new MASSACRE album, whom both were members of.  After their departure from the group the following year they teamed up with fellow former MASSACRE, and current OBITUARY  member  Terry Butler (Bass) and formed INHUMAN CONDITION.

SUN OF THE SUNS Reveal Debut Album ‘TIIT’ Details

Posted by tarjavirmakari on June 17, 2021
Posted in: Int. News, News. Tagged: SUN OF THE SUNS. Leave a comment

Extreme metal visionaries SUN OF THE SUNS have released the details of their debut album ‘TIIT’, set to be released on August 20th by Scarlet Records.

Formed by members of established extreme metal acts such as Carnality, The Modern Age Slavery and Nightland, Sun of the Suns is a new, exciting musical project consisting of vocalist Luca Scarlatti and guitarists Marco Righetti and Ludovico Cioffi.

The album features Simone Mularoni (DGM, Empyrios) on bass and Fleshgod Apocalypse’s maestro Francesco Paoli on drums and was produced, recorded, mixed and mastered by Simone Mularoni himself at Domination Studio (San Marino). The artwork was created by Ludovico Cioffi.

ROBERT JON & THE WRECK Announce New Album + Single “Shine A Light On Me Brother”

Posted by tarjavirmakari on June 17, 2021
Posted in: Int. News, News. Tagged: ROBERT JON & THE WRECK. Leave a comment
Photo Credit Bryan Greenberg

ROBERT JON & THE WRECK are back and ready to tear up the UK and Europe all over again with their new record, Shine A Light On Me Brother. The impressive new album, written and recorded during the COVID pandemic, and self-produced by Robert Jon & The Wreck, will be released on Friday September 3, 2021.

The title track Shine A Light On Me Brother, will be released as a single on Friday June 25th. Pre-save the single on Spotify and pre-order the album from https://ffm.to/rjtwshine. 

Watch the official trailer for the forthcoming single HERE.

Robert Jon & The Wreck is comprised of Robert Jon Burrison (lead vocals, guitar), Andrew Espantman (drums, b. vocals), Steve Maggiora (keyboards, b. vocals), Henry James (lead guitar, b. vocals), and Warren Murrel (bass, b. vocals).

Robert Jon & The Wreck will take the new album on tour in September/October 2021 and February, April, May, June, and July 2022. The tour will hit the UK in September with special guest Troy Redfern. Tickets for the UK dates are available from www.alttickets.com and www.planetrocktickets.co.uk.

Shine a Light on Me Brother will be available on CD, Vinyl, limited Deluxe Vinyl (coloured) and in limited edition bundles – including a deluxe bundle including the Signed Deluxe Edition Vinyl, Ltd Edition T-shirt, signed CD, Ltd Edition retro California vanity plates, and signed Ltd Edition photos of Robert Jon & The Wreck. Pre-order the album from https://ffm.to/rjtwshine and www.robertjonandthewreck.com.  

Robert Jon & The Wreck have supported the likes of Joe Bonamassa, Buddy Guy, Eric Gales, Living Colour, Chris Robinson Brotherhood, Walter Trout, Rival Sons, Robert Randolph & The Family Band, Lukas Nelson & Promise of the Real, The Cadillac Three, Black Stone Cherry, Devon Allman Band, Billy Sheehan, Sturgill Simpson, and many more. 

Robert Jon & The Wreck has been writing songs and releasing albums since the band’s conception in 2011. During this time, this quintet of follicular proficient gentlemen has been busy fine-tuning their sound playing to packed houses across Europe and the United States.

The band have received accolades and rave reviews for years now, from nominations of “Best Rock” and “Best Blues” and winning the title of “Best Live Band” at the Orange County Music Awards in 2013, to numerous top 10 chart placement on Southern Rock Brazil’s Top 20 Albums to being praised as “Classic and fresh at the same time” by Rock The Best Music, “Raising the bar for the Southern genre” by Blues Rock Review, and “keeping the history of classic 60’s and 70’s rock alive for newer generations” by blues guitar legend Joe Bonamassa.
